About the wireframe kit
Paper is the ultimate wireframing tool for building quick concept mockups and prototypes, with full creative freedom.
We use the oversized version of the wireframe kit in our digital psychology training, where we focus on applying psychology to various interactive design, UX and marketing applications.
Since our focus is on creative concepts, rather than pixel-perfect specifications, the kit provides ballpark dimensions across a wide range of popular devices, for websites, apps, wearables, advertising and more.
This wireframe kit does not include our training system; only device specifications.



Prototype specifications
Our grid system is inspired by the Bootstrap CSS system and uses a format that is convenient for adaptive or responsive breakpoints, at 3, 4, or 6 column divisions.
The grid is 1,200 pixels wide, divided into 12 columns, with dark gridlines every 100 pixels, each with 10 light gridlines, each at 10 pixels. This is a rough approximation of the sizes typically used in grid systems, with some smaller and others larger.
Our prototype wireframe specifications follow the proportions of popular products, such as the iPhone 8, iPad Air, and Apple Watch Series 3.
Our Facebook ad templates are based on 1200x1200 and 1200x628 pixels, which are common image dimensions used across various social media ad platforms.
Our banner ad templates are based on the most common display advertising formats used in Google's adaptive ads and AdRoll’s remarketing banners.

Game Design Theory

Game Design Theory



How designers silently tell you what to do? - Affordances and Signifiers
Sometimes, you just look at a thing and know how it works. That's not an accident - it's good design, called affordance, and it can be applied to video games.
source: Extra Credits

______

Learn how to design game environments so that the environment tells the player what to do. Affordances are a way we can design something in our game so it communicates the way we are supposed to interact with it via it's form. If you take the example of a cup, people intuitively know how to pick it up because the big round handle looks like it can be grasped. We can apply this logic to objects in game design and level design. By constructing their form in a certain way, the player will intuitively know what to do with the object. This is often considered a form of user experience design.

Signifiers are things we add to objects when an affordance is not 100% clear. These signifiers can be words, symbols or other things, but we put them onto objects to hint at an affordance or to flat out tell a user what to do. We can take advantage of these in a similar way we took advantage of affordances by using them to guide the player with more difficult interactions.

There are many situations in games where we leverage affordance when we play. In this video we cover a number of examples and I explain in depth the definition of these terms we have been discussing. We will cover the classic door design example where we design door handles to fit the way a door opens. We also talk about how affordance isn't just for environment design but is applied all over different disciplines of design including combat design.

Affordances and Constraints in game design process


In his article Affordance, Conventions and Design, Norman emphasizes the difference between perceived affordance and affordance.[1] Thus, affordance can not be understood as feedback made by system when we are using screen-based equipment and instead it should be explained as something that “provide strong clues to the operations of things”, according to DOET written by Norman[2]. In general, affordance serves as the role that leads users and consumers to think, learn, analyze and interact.

As a representative form of interactive media, video games never lack materials for us to research design principles such as affordances, constraints and conventions.[3]

1.HUD design in video games

When we talk about interactive media, it is inevitable to talk about user interface and user experience. As for video games, a player can not judge the quality of gameplay when he first starts adventure, but he can decide whether the art style is to his liking or not once he sees the title. Jesse Schell in his book The Art of Game Design explicitly explain the hierarchical mental structure of players’ cognition. Even though for designers, mechanism, story, aesthetics and technology are equally important, the first two things players notice are usually aesthetics and mechanism maybe because these two are most easily to be symbolized.[4] So the combination of aesthetics and mechanism should provide players with enough affordances.

Games, especially the role-playing game, often leave tons of information for players to learn. Obviously, game designers in modern age will not list everything on screen just as their predecessors did. Instead they just place the most important information, such as hit point, mana point and ammunition, on the screen. Actually, the important information presented on screen is called Head Up Display (HUD), which is originally used in military area, describing the parameters shown in cockpit. To keep the HUD interface as concise as possible, one strategy is integrating the information into game contents.
The ammunition design of COD: AW

In Call of Duty: Advanced Warfare, designers cleverly make the ammunition information one part of the guns (the number will move as you move the gun and change view), giving players clear information that it is something related to weapons.

However, this strategy does not make game mechanism clear all the time. Metro 2033 uses the watch to indicate the duration of gas mask. It is really a good idea if players have been familiar with the game mechanism, but the vague and indirect relationship between mask and watch can frustrate new players at first. In contrast, Call of Duty: Black Ops uses the cracks on mask to warn players, which is a more intuitive design.

The watch design of check gas mask is somewhat confusing

2.Map and interactive elements design

It is the responsibility of game designers to tell players what they should and should not do during the gaming process. HUD serves as the instructor of player from beginning to end, but it is not enough for players to do well when they are required to make an immediate response. So designers should leave hints to players.

One thing that designers are good at is using both affordance and constraint to give players instructions. In many action games, players have to manipulate their characters to climb cliffs or trees and jump over chasms. Under such circumstances, designers often mark rocks that can be climbed and restrict characters to access those areas that can not interact with players.
The climbable part in Rise of the Tomb Raider is different from other parts
In Rise of the Tomb Raider, the ice that can be climbed is evidently lighter than the unclimbable part. What’s more, it is a standard design in the whole game, meaning the pattern of climbable part can be understood instinctively by players.

Another common trick used by game designers is setting margin for map with seemingly accessible perspective. I guess every player of Counter-Strike has the experience of fleeing outside the map. A more intricate way is to destroy the environment intentionally in order to force players to move to the next scene, especially in some linear cinematic games. Naughty Dog is the master of using such a strategy. In Uncharted franchise games, players must keep moving to avoid being buried by collapsed houses and cliffs, which in turn destroy the scene and stop characters from going back. This constraint ensures that players can have compact gaming process and have no problem with finding the destination.

3.Thoughts of future game design

Murray in her book Inventing the medium listed four affordances for digital artifacts: encyclopedic, spatial, procedural, and participatory.[5] Intrinsically a computer program, video game itself of course own the four affordances. For example, RTS(Real-Time Strategy) and MOBA(Multiplayer Online Battle Arena) games produce infinite possibilities for players and professional tournaments with bonus of millions of dollars. Compared to legacy media, video game is totally multisequential and interactive.

However, the complexity and flexibility of video game have brought designers a question – how to know what players really like. In traditional media age, users receive information passively, so designers only have to consider the transmission process from one direction and in digital media age, especially during the process of designing HCL system, designers should select the appropriate conventions that human interactors can understand, according to Murray.[5] Modern video game design is based on the mature media like movies and novels and asks designers to consider the balance between mechanism, story, aesthetics and technology. The problem here is that players have different preferences so designers can only accumulate experience by making mistakes to set good conceptual models for most players. A typical example is the failure of No Man’s Sky, whose developers are seduced by new technologies. [5] They create an universe by automatic random algorithm but neglect the importance of level design, thus making the world vapid, sterile and repetitive.

In general, game design is a formidable process and requires developers to correctly construct conceptual model for most players and make clear affordances, constraints and conventions.

The Gamer’s Brain

Game Developers Conference - GDC 2016 video presentation



Discovering and mastering a video game is a learning experience for the user. It requires mental efforts. This is why it’s important to understand how the brain learns to craft a compelling onboarding experience – one worth putting effort into, one that will matter to your audience.

Anything the brain processes and learns originates from a perceived input and changes the memory of a subject. The quality of the processing – therefore the quality of the retention – depends highly on the attentional resources applied, which are also dependent on the emotions and motivation felt by the players. In sum, to improve the experience of the players, video game developers must take into account the perception, memory, and attention limitations of the brain, as well as the emotions and motivation felt by the players.

Can you have a great product with bad UX?

Can you have a great product with bad UX?



Is it possible for a product to be high-quality and have bad UX? To answer this question about bad user experience, we must first preface it by defining, “a great product.”
Is a great product the same as a successful one? If we measure a product’s greatness by its ubiquity or gross revenue — the answer is yes. There are plenty of everyday items with horrific UX that continue to be in bought and used.
This can occur because there is simply no better substitute, or we have become so accustomed to the concept we no longer notice its inefficiencies.
Consider your keyboard. The symbol placement is far from intuitive — to the point that there is an entire industry of software dedicated to onboarding young users. Yet, it remains the standard.
The vast majority of products with bad UX will not have the far-reaching success of the keyboard, and even then — they will never truly be “great products.”
Truly great products do not have bad UX. 
Here is why:


It might serve a purpose, but it doesn’t fulfil its potential
Let’s talk about the standard printer for example — notorious for confusing buttons, erratic behaviours and almost guaranteed user frustration.
It fills a need so people continue to buy it — especially if the alternatives have equally bad UX. However, the gap in usability must be filled with a crutch: heavy customer service, rigorous onboarding or aggressive marketing.
Patching up your product’s UX problem instead of fixing it at the root will quickly run up a tab.

Just ask any company that sells a printer how often their customer service representatives hear about various printing malfunctions.
Simply put, a product with bad UX is a product that could be better. Companies that do not improve UX are missing an opportunity to create a truly great product.


Frustration will turn to user churn
Providing a great user experience is critical for keeping users engaged. A product which causes user frustration will be abandoned — just as soon as something better comes along. Take CDs for example.
Once the go-to means of listening to music, the CD left much to be desired in terms of user experience. They were delicate and easy to break, awkward to store and expensive to collect. This left them vulnerable to user churn as soon as MP3 technology hit the market.
From a business perspective, a product with bad UX is an unstable investment as a competitor could easily improve upon the concept and gain a competitive edge.


UX is constantly evolving
User experience has existed long before the buzzword was coined, and has continued to evolve in many products we use every day. The telephone’s evolution is just one prominent example.
In the age of the customer, growing demands for better user experience has stipulated an influx of more intuitive products and software. This shift marks a turning point where UX is no longer an added bonus, but rather a means for survival.

Usable Products

Usable Products


BASIC UX — A Framework for Usable Products


The problem is this…
While information and opinions on ‘good UX’ are increasing in availability, teams, organizations, and individuals still struggling to define, measure, and agree upon principles of UX in a productive manner. That is, a lot of UX discussions end in design arguments. Meanwhile, the developers are waiting for direction, the designers are waiting for a correction, and the end-users are waiting for a satisfying experience.

BASIC UX does not set out to be the ‘end all, be all’ of UX principles. It does set out to help solve or at least reduce the problem stated above — UX design in productive environments is harder than it should be.

A set of common principles that test something’s overall user experience.

First, each letter in the word BASIC stands for a UX principle.

  • Beauty
  • Accessibility
  • Simplicity
  • Intuitiveness
  • Consistency

______________

Beautiful

Is it aesthetically pleasant?

The look and feel of a product are important to its overall user experience. The Aesthetic-Usability Effect shows that a visually appealing design is perceived as easier to use than an ugly one. Developers should refer to style guides and design specs for reference here. A few pixels can make a design look ‘off’ and leave the product feeling ‘broken.’

Questions to ask

Is it aesthetically pleasant?
Does it follows the style guide? (Attractive things work better)
Are high-quality images and graphics used? (balance with size optimization)
Is it properly aligned with the layout?

__________

Accessible

Can ‘everyone’ use it?

A product’s accessibility is measured by how available and usable it is for people, regardless of their ability. Developers must go beyond the ‘average’ user and ensure that those with disabilities are also able to use the product. These disabilities might include: poor or no vision, color blindness, lack of motor skills, lower than average intelligence, etc. In these cases, third-party software such as mouse-dictation and screen readers are often used to navigate and perform actions within the product. Using existing standards such as WCAG, 508 compliant, and W3C will help increase the overall accessibility of the product. Subtle accessibility impacts should also be kept in mind when choosing font size, colors, and animations.

Questions to ask

Does it comply with standards? (WCAG, 508 compliant, W3C)
Is it cross-browser compatible? (IE8–11, CH, FF, SF)
Is it ‘display’ responsive?
Is the language simple enough for most to understand?

__________ 

Simple

Does it make life easier?

Hick’s Law states that the time it takes to make a decision is proportionally related to the number and complexity of choices. Additionally, Ockham’s Razor states that simplicity should be the deciding factor when choosing between two identical designs. Developers must then create user interfaces that distill the options to only what is needed to perform the user’s task.

Visually, this means balancing the use of white space and alignments to create associations, rather than complex graphics and styling. The Principles of Gestalt informs us that the use of distance, alignments and color similarities can help guide a product in a clean, simple and intuitive manner. For language content, this means reducing redundancy, removing passivity and filler words.

Questions to ask

Does it reduce the user’s workload? (automate where possible, reduce user’s workload)
Is it free of clutter and repetitive text? (Cognitive load, DRY text, KISS)
Is its functionality necessary? (YAGNI)

________ 

Intuitive

Is it easy to use?

The Gulfs of Evaluation and Execution (Norman 1986) help us understand the usability gaps that users face in any system. Evaluation happens when the user is trying to understand the state of the system. If the state is not clear, the user might unnecessarily repeat an action, or feel a sense of anxiety that their task wasn’t completed. Execution is needed for a user to achieve their goals. If the path of execution is unclear, then the user won’t know how to achieve their goals in the system. If either one of these “gulfs” are too wide, then users will not have a good experience in the system and will dread using it.

Affordance is another key aspect of an intuitive UX. For example, the color of links or the shape of buttons indicates that there is an action available. It’s import to realize that most people spend most of their time with other products and in other systems. Thus, building upon established design patterns is key.

Questions to ask

Is the functionality clear (Affordance and Gulfs of Evaluation/Execution)
Can the user achieve their goal with little or no initial instructions?
Is the task easily repeated by the user without further instruction?
Can the user predict the outcome/output?

_________ 

Consistent

Does it match the system?

Consistency is the thread that holds BASIC UX together. A beautiful product is consistent. An accessible product is consistent. A simple product is consistent. An intuitive product is consistent. In UX, consistency is the thing that separates frustrating chaos from cohesive harmony. It is important that design colors, spacing, fonts and alignments are uniform throughout the product. This visual and functional uniformity creates a sense of dependability and trust between the user and the system.

Developers should reuse existing and established elements in the system whenever possible. Forms should have consistent alerts, labels, validation, and action behaviors. If consistency is lacking, then the entire UX will be as well. Performance glitches should be minimized so that pages load as a consistent rate and actions produce predictable responses.

Questions to ask

Does it reuse existing Interfaces/Interaction?
Is its language, images, and branding consistent with the system?
Does it appear in the right place at the right time? (workflow, navigation, visual hierarchy and information architecture)
Does it perform consistently every time?

__________ 

Conclusion

User Experience Design is at the forefront of product management in today’s industries. However, in spite of this vast and growing knowledge-share on the topic, UX Design is still a difficult area to gain team consensus around. It is in these situations that frameworks can provide clear direction. BASIC UX is a user experience design framework made up of five key design principles. It strives to help developers and designers guide their products in the right direction while remaining productive in the development process. I encourage you to introduce BASIC UX to your team and use it to enhance the experiences your products deliver.

5 Things Everyone Should Know About UX Work

5 Things Everyone Should Know About UX Work


The howls of frustration that we hear on many UX projects are often to do with how badly misunderstood the UX role is in business. Here are 5 things that everyone should know about UX work:

1. UX Research is Essential

The first barrier to many a UX project is people in the company who think they already know the customer inside out.

“We’ve done plenty of market research, just tell us what you need to know and we’ll tell you,” comes the offer of many a helpful marketing manager or project manager. In reality, we don’t care about their market research—we need to talk to users to build up a profile in relationship to the use of the product and not how they interact with the company in general. Market research is about broad trends in customers and what they are likely to buy; UX research is about individual behaviours of users when they use a product. These are different things, and without talking to users, we can’t know how they see the product or develop one of those lovely user personas that we need.


2. UX Work Tends to Be Iterative

While it doesn’t look like we’ve done all that much since the last time you popped your head round the door, in truth, we’re 5 versions farther along the lines towards a product our customers will like. To make great products, we make lots of changes and test them. Then we bury the changes that don’t make enough of a difference. We keep doing this until we finally have a product that’s substantially better than either our last one or the competitor’s offerings. It takes time, and it’s not exciting to look at from outside our labs, but it’s also very much necessary.


3. We Can’t Show You a “Process”

We warn against treating UX work as a “one size fits all” process. Sadly, this behaviour can alienate some clients, and in some cases, clients might even demand this from the outset.

“Show us your process and we’ll tell you how it fits in with our product,” they might claim.

You need to step back and explain that each process should be somewhat unique, as each product is somewhat unique and as each user base is also somewhat unique. Your clients don’t want a standard process really; they just think they do and you may have to wean them off the idea.


4. Yes, We Have to Test

If you want products that users love, then we have to test them. Sure, we UX folks are experts in our field, but we’re not your users. Our job is to refine ideas to the point that we can hand them over to your users to tell is if we got it right or not. This may be time consuming, but it’s the only assurance you have that we’re really moving in the right direction too.


5. UX is More than Usability

Usability is important, but the user experience is more than usability. We like how Apple has managed to get usability on the strategic radar, but usability alone is not enough. Usability is the bare minimum requirement of a product that is released; UX includes everything else that makes the difference between “it works” and “it wows!”
